1. History and development of internet poker Ranking:
Online poker ranking methods first emerged during the early 2000s, after the poker increase. Back then, platforms like Sharkscope and certified Poker Rankings (OPR) gained popularity by monitoring and displaying players’ competition results and profits. These systems primarily centered on providing statistics to help players evaluate their particular overall performance and get a benefit over their particular opponents.
However, as on-line poker became much more competitive, standing methods started integrating extra elements particularly leaderboard tournaments and player rating systems. This move aimed to foster a sense of competition, pushing people to focus on greater positioning and recognition from their particular colleagues.
2. Different Types of Online Poker Ranking Techniques:
These days, players get access to various on-line poker ranking methods that use diverse methodologies in evaluating people' performances. Although some methods consider money online game results, others prioritize tournament accomplishments or a mixture of both.
One commonly used standing system could be the Global Poker Index (GPI), which gained extensive recognition because impartial and accurate analysis techniques. The GPI utilizes a scoring formula that weighs tournaments' buy-ins, industry dimensions, and players' finishing opportunities. Consequently, the system presents a target position that ranks people predicated on their consistent performance in prestigious real time tournaments.
Furthermore, online systems like PocketFives and Sharkscope offer positioning centered on players' on line competition performances solely. These systems track players' results across a variety of on-line poker websites, allowing individuals to compare their performance against other individuals inside internet poker neighborhood.
3. Ramifications of Online Poker Ranking:
On-line poker ranking systems have manifold ramifications for people, providers, while the overall poker neighborhood. Firstly, these systems foster competition, as people attempt to climb within the positions ladder, fundamentally enhancing the entire level of skill associated with the player pool. Furthermore, ranking methods motivate players to boost their particular gameplay, research strategies, and commit longer and effort to on-line poker.
For providers, on-line poker ranking methods act as a marketing device to attract even more players. By highlighting the accomplishments of high-ranking players in on line tournaments, providers can create a powerful neighborhood and generate an aggressive environment that encourages involvement.
However, it is important to see that on-line poker ranking systems are not without their limits. The systems mostly target people' competition shows and can even maybe not precisely reflect their particular general skills in every poker alternatives. Additionally, some people may adjust their positioning by participating in discerning tournaments or exploiting the device's flaws, undermining the competitive stability of internet poker.
